Accra Academy old students congratulate GFA Exco member Anim Addo

The Accra Academy Old Boys Association has sent a message of congratulations to Samuel Anim Addo for his election onto the Executive Council of the Ghana Football Association.

In a statement signed by its president, the group expressed delight with Anim’s ascension onto the apex committee of Ghana football and urged him to discharge his duties in accordance with the school’s principles and beliefs.

“We are delighted with considerable hope that your capabilities and skills coupled with the Esse Quam Videri spirit will help restore the Ghanaian sports landscape notably football”, excerpts of the statement read.

Anim is one of three persons elected to represent Division One clubs on the newly-constituted Executive Council of the GFA.

Anim who is the manager of legendary Ghanaian striker Asamoah Gyan polled 19 votes to secure a seat on the committee.

After the victory, he joined fellow 'Bleoobi' Randy Abbey to sing the school’s anthem.

He has now emerged as one of the frontrunners for the FA’s vice presidential post.
